About Copper Spoon
Located in the scenic suburb of Golden Beach on the Sunshine Coast, Copper Spoon offers a delightful Thai dining experience that sets it apart from others in the area. The restaurant boasts a warm and inviting atmosphere, where vibrant décor meets the soothing sounds of the nearby ocean. Guests can indulge in authentic Thai flavours, with the signature Market Fish dish showcasing the freshest local catch, supporting the community's fishery. Unique to Copper Spoon is their monthly cooking class, held on the last Sunday, where patrons can learn the art of Thai cuisine directly from skilled chefs. This combination of exceptional food and immersive experiences makes Copper Spoon a must-visit culinary gem.

Best Thai restaurant ever
never thought u would find such a great Thai restaurant in Caloundra! The green curry we had was just so good that we didn't leave a drop on the bowl. The red snapper with tamarind sauce was also my favourite. The owner said all seafood used in house are from mooloobala. I think that's pretty good how they support locals. the setting was so lovely and clean. Also we did enjoy their friendly attentive service.
This is easily the best Thai I've eaten and I've tried lots of Thai restaurants in Brisbane. You can't go past the fish cakes that are made on site and also the prawn spring rolls. So delicious! The setting/decor/outlook is great. Only thing is that it's quite expensive but the food is totally worth it!
